Abatable provides carbon market procurement, intelligence, and advisory services for organizations buying or supplying carbon credits. Its platform covers project sourcing, evaluation, procurement monitoring, price trends, and policy alerts, with advisory support for strategy workshops and custom reporting. The company says it has sourced 1 billion carbon credits for clients and deployed over 55 million high-integrity credits.
Abatable's main competitors in the voluntary carbon market include:
BeZero: This company focuses on project-level carbon ratings, assessing the quality and risk of carbon projects at various stages of their life cycle. This approach helps organizations make informed climate investment decisions by providing detailed insights into the projects they are considering.
Sylvera: Sylvera develops a carbon offset rating platform that offers clarity and performance metrics for carbon markets. It assists corporate sustainability leaders and asset managers in evaluating and investing in carbon credits through its proprietary framework for assessing carbon credit quality.
Patch: Patch provides a technology platform aimed at accelerating climate solutions within the carbon credit market. It primarily serves the environmental sustainability sector, focusing on facilitating transactions and improving the efficiency of carbon credit exchanges.
Notable differences include BeZero's emphasis on project-level ratings, Sylvera's proprietary assessment framework, and Patch's technology-driven approach to carbon credit transactions, which distinguishes them from Abatable's broader end-to-end carbon market solutions.
